Jay reports his settings, and set-up, for this picture as follows:
Shot with a Canon EOS 5D + 24-105mm f/4L IS
Shutter Speed 1/125s
Aperture f/8
ISO 100
Studio set-up for this shot: Two Elinchrom 600RX with soft boxes mounted. Background was simply white foam core set up on a card table. Drink was real margarita mix (virgin) with real salt and a real red chili pepper. Exposure was set to slightly blow out the white background to minimize dodging in post.
